Namesake of the U.S.S. Gonzalez

Sergeant Alfredo Cantu Gonzalez enlisted in the Marine Corps in June 1965. He served as a rifleman with 1st Reconnaissance Battalion for a year, then served with 3rd Marine Division (Rein), where he was promoted to Private First Class on January 1, 1966; to Lance Corporal on October 1, 1966, and to Corporal on December 1, 1966.
On July 1, 1967, Gonzalez was promoted to Sergeant just prior to arriving in Vietnam. He served there as Platoon Sergeant with the 3rd Platoon Company “A”, 1st Battalion. During Operation Hue City on February 4, 1968, Gonzalez was killed by rocket fire. He earned the Congressional Medal of Honor, the Purple Heart, and the National Defense Service Medal, among others.
